Awards and Grants

2009-10 Marie Curie Fellowship (Transfer of Knowledge), University of Cambridge and Krakow AGH University of Science and Technology, Poland.

2006 Armourers and Brasiers’ Company Research Fellowship and Award in recognition of recent research on joining advanced materials.

2004-05 Smart Award from DTI for CAMJET (Cambridge Advanced Method for Joining Engine Turbines). Total of £60,000 was raised for one-year of work in the University of Cambridge.

2001-02 Full Research Grant from Centre Francais pour l’Accueil et les Échanges Internationaux (EGIDE), Paris, France. Awarded a full research grant for 11 months to develop a new joining method in École Polytechnique de l’Université de Nantes.

1999 Cook/Ablett Award from the Institute of Materials, Minerals and Mining, London, UK, for an outstanding published paper in the field of metals.

1998 International Henry Granjon Prize from the International Institute of Welding (IIW) for developing a novel bonding method for advanced aluminium alloys and composites.

1997 Lundgren Award from University of Cambridge in recognition of PhD research.

1995-97 Overseas Research Students Award (ORS) from the Committee of Vice-Chancellors and Principals of the Universities of the United Kingdom.
